Description
A beautiful lift-the-flap board book from the National Trust for little nature lovers everywhere!
There are lots of animals at the seaside, but where are they hiding and what are they doing? In this charming lift-the-flap book, little ones can pore over the beautiful collaged pages and explore under rocks, seashells and seaweed to find out interesting facts about seaside wildlife. With over 20 tiny flaps in each book, there’s so much to discover.
Full of sturdy flaps and simple facts, this is the perfect introduction to the outdoors.
